Thomas Huelshorst
In 2002 Thomas Hülshorst joined FEV. His first position was to care about SW development and system simulation for fuel cell systems. As a Senior Technical expert, he worked in the following years on the application of artificial neural networks in powertrain control and model-based calibration methods. In 2006 he took over the department of Vehicle Electronics and Electrification. Main areas of activities were automotive E/E system development and integration, including diagnostics and In-Vehicle network. During this time, he introduced and established battery development as well as Software for Battery Management Systems (BMS) and Powertrain controls (VCU) as a new focus area of FEV. In 2012, he was promoted to Director Vehicle Electronics & E-Mobility and subsequently took over the management of the “Electronics and Electrification” business unit as Vice President at FEV Europe GmbH in 2013. In this position, the E/E and SW development activities were expanded, and Connectivity and ADAS/AD development were introduced as a new engineering areas as well as power electronics. Changing to FEV Group GmbH in 2016, he took over the global management of the Business Unit Electronics and Electrification in 2016 in the position of Group Vice president. Due to further growth and expansion, the business unit was split into the two new units “Electric Powertrain” and “Intelligent Mobility and Software” in 2019. To give the second business unit more visibility, it was spun off under the new global brand FEV.io in 2022. The portfolio was expanded towards SW&EE Platform development (incl. SDV), eCockpit and Cyber Security. To date, Thomas Hülshorst is responsible for both business units and global FEV.io brand as Group Vice President.

Thomas Tasky
Tom Tasky is Vice President of FEV.io, the Intelligent Mobility, Machinery, and Software division of FEV North America Inc. He is responsible for leading the organization's innovation and emerging vehicle and machinery development technology competencies including Software Defined Vehicle (SDV) development, software development including AI, ML, ADAS/AD, and connectivity, as well as systems engineering including functional safety and cybersecurity for a wide range of industries and applications. Tom has over 30 years of industry experience, ranging from powertrain systems development, electrical systems development and integration including vehicle diagnostics and networking for prototype and series production programs for gasoline, battery electric, hybrid, and automated vehicles.
